    Unhappy New home on wheels

    We brought our 303RLS home this past Saturday, opened out the slides and today it rained and the slide the fireplace is on leaked and the fireplace won't turn on either. After a call to GD and much discussion it was decided the circuit board is out in the fireplace and will need another one. The water leak is another story as I have to take it back to the dealer for repairs and they can't get to it till next week not to mention I will have put 320 miles on it once I bring it back home. Customer service has been great over the phone so far but I'm not feeling the love as far as the selling dealer is concerned.

    The dealer says he has identified the problem at the bottom of the slides. As you retract the slide the bottom gaskest roll or fold causing a gap while towing when the roads are wet. I think GD should issue a TSB "Do Not Tow When Roads Are Wet". Just kidding but I am a little frustrated with their reported great customer service. I am not feeling helped at all. I only get the standard answers from Ryan Prough, Warranty Manager at GD. I requested to please extend the warranty as it relates to water leak issues and he said no.
